  • IBM Connects WebSphere MQ and Sterling MFT Offerings

    April 12, 2011 Alex Woodie

    IBM i customers who use WebSphere MQ for inter-server messaging and Sterling Commerce Connect:Direct for B2B file transfers can now integrate those two environments with a new release of WebSphere MQ File Transfer Edition introduced by IBM last week.

    WebSphere MQ File Transfer Edition offers MFT capabilities in addition to including a full copy of WebSphere MQ, the underlying messaging platform that provides integration capabilities for many IBM i and z/OS shops. The capability to handle both server-to-server messaging and ad hoc MFT in a single product drove the creation of WebSphere MQ File Transfer Edition, which runs on IBM i servers.

    Last week, IBM announced WebSphere MQ File Transfer Edition version 7.0.4. This version provides a bridge that links the MFT functions of WebSphere MQ File Transfer Edition into customers’ existing Sterling’s Connect:Direct environments. This allows customers to leverage their investments in both products, IBM says.

    In addition to the Connect:Direct bridge, IBM delivered audit trail enhancements that add details of file transfers that traverse Connect:Direct networks and documentation that describes how to transfer files to and from existing Connect:Direct environments.

    WebSphere MQ File Transfer Edition version 7.0.4 ships on June 3. The multiplatform version of the software runs on multiple servers, including IBM i servers loaded with the PASE AIX runtime. For specific IBM i requirements, see IBM United States Software Announcement 211-093 (.pdf).
